Dear Reddy, being an engineering student, you should know that radio frequency is controlled by regulatory body TRAI in India and ITU internationally. What you are asking is for actually Ham radio (amateur radio) and that will have limited usage. Amateur radio (also called ham radio) is the use of designated radio frequency spectrum for purposes of private recreation, non-commercial exchange of messages, wireless experimentation, self-training, and emergency communication.
